There is an old water trough by a pen that is no longer in use that started leaking mad water over the weekend while I was out at the cat ranch trying unsuccessfully to find pheasant.

I took it apart and it looks like the "stop cap" on the end of the water pipe in the trough had split (was down in the teens at night) and was spraying water out like a fountain.

It was the night before I left and I couldn't find an individual water turn off for that trough so I'm going to have to replace the cap on the pipe when I'm out there over Thanksgiving weekend. I turned the water well for the house/pens off before I left so we don't have a monster electric bill due to the pump running 24/7.

My dad is currently in the middle of a 2 week long cruise and does not have cell service so I couldn't ask him what to do.

How would you rank ben ji's city boy farm decision making abilities?

(Important side note, there are no cows or other animals currently out there that would need access to the other non broken water troughs)
Felt like a real farm person when I fixed this today.

Old cap and new cap, no water is leaking now.
